DeSantis Rages At Trump’s Accusations Of “Disloyalty”

“Disloyal to who? I mean, you know, politicians have to earn support. They’re not entitled to support. I did a lot for him in 2016 and 2020. By the way, I was happy to do it. But at the end of the day, you know, I’m loyal to my family, to our Constitution, and to the good lord.

“And I have a vision. I think I’m the guy that can beat Biden.  But even more importantly, no more excuses on these issues. I’m going to get all of this stuff done.

“We’ll have a plan on day one to get going and get cracking. We’ll give you two great terms for eight years and really get the country on a fundamentally different path.

“I think I’m the guy that do it. And so I have the responsibility to step up and serve.” – Ron DeSantis, after Fox host Jesse Watters asked him about Trump’s many “disloyalty” accusations.
